Course Description

Overview 

This foundation programme provides a rigorous academic bridge into the analytical study of fundamental questions concerning existence, knowledge, values, and reason. Designed to equip you with the essential intellectual and humanities frameworks required for higher education, the course thoroughly prepares you for the full BA (Hons) Philosophy degree at Durham University. By engaging with this preparatory year, you will establish a robust theoretical baseline necessary to critically examine complex ideas, deconstruct arguments, and explore the historical development of philosophical thought.

What You'll Learn

  • Fundamental concepts across the core branches of philosophy, including ethics, epistemology (theory of knowledge), metaphysics, and logic.

  • Introductory analysis of highly influential philosophical texts from both historical and contemporary thinkers.

  • Core methodologies for evaluating complex arguments, identifying logical fallacies, and constructing well-reasoned intellectual positions.

  • The application of philosophical theories to modern societal, political, and ethical dilemmas.

  • Essential academic research skills, encompassing how to locate, interpret, and accurately cite scholarly literature and primary texts.

  • Structured academic communication, emphasizing the construction of persuasive philosophical essays, logical reasoning, and clear verbal argumentation.

Requirements

Kuwait : Completion of High School / Shahadat Al-Thanawiya Al-A'ama (General Secondary Education Certificate) with a minimum overall average of 80%
UKVI IELTS (Academic) 5.5 with 5.5 in Reading and Writing and no band below 5.0 (or approved SELT equivalent).
